Upper Structure of Rear Pillar of Vehicle with Reinforced Stiffness - A simplified explanation of the abstract

This abstract first appeared for US patent application 18341102 titled 'Upper Structure of Rear Pillar of Vehicle with Reinforced Stiffness

Simplified Explanation: The embodiment upper structure of a rear pillar of a vehicle consists of a roof side member, a roof center member, and a seat belt mounting member.

  • The roof side member is positioned on the side surface of the roof in the length direction of the vehicle.
  • The roof center member is located at the rear end of the roof in the width direction of the vehicle and is connected to the rear end of the roof side member.
  • The seat belt mounting member is connected to the end portion of the roof side member.

Original Abstract Submitted

An embodiment upper structure of a rear pillar of a vehicle includes a roof side member disposed on a side surface of a roof in a length direction of the vehicle, a roof center member disposed at a rear end of the roof in a width direction of the vehicle and connected to a side surface of a rear end of the roof side member, and a seat belt mounting member connected to an end portion of the roof side member.
